Beide Seiten der vorigen RevisionVorhergehende ÜberarbeitungNächste Überarbeitung | Vorhergehende ÜberarbeitungNächste ÜberarbeitungBeide Seiten der Revision |
de:create:functions:mailresume [10.12.2014 14:16] – Beispiel ergänzt admin | de:create:functions:mailresume [27.02.2020 10:46] – admin |
---|
====== mailResume() ====== | ====== mailResume() ====== |
| |
''void **mailResume**(string //PersonID//, int //Serienmail//, int //Zeitpunkt//, [string //C1//, string //C2//, string //C3//])'' | ''void **mailResume**(string //PersonID//, int //Serienmail//, int //Zeitpunkt//, [string //C1//, string //C2//, string //C3//, string //C4//, string //C5//])'' |
| |
Diese Funktion versendet im laufenden Interview eine E-Mail mit einem Link, um das Interview später fortzusetzen. Dies ist vor allem in Verbindung mit einer gezielten Unterbrechung in mehrwelligen Erhebungen sinnvoll (''[[:de:create:functions:buttonhide|buttonHide()]]''). | Diese Funktion versendet im laufenden Interview eine E-Mail mit einem Link, um das Interview später fortzusetzen. Dies ist vor allem in Verbindung mit einer gezielten Unterbrechung in mehrwelligen Erhebungen sinnvoll (''[[:de:create:functions:buttonhide|buttonHide()]]''). |
* //Serienmail//\\ (Numerische) Kennung der Serienmail, die an den Teilnehmer verschickt werden soll. Im Karteireiter //Erinnerungen/Folgemail// der Serienmail muss für //Art der Folgemail// der Wert "Erinnerung oder Fortsetzung" eingestellt sein. Bitte beachten Sie die Hinweise unten. | * //Serienmail//\\ (Numerische) Kennung der Serienmail, die an den Teilnehmer verschickt werden soll. Im Karteireiter //Erinnerungen/Folgemail// der Serienmail muss für //Art der Folgemail// der Wert "Erinnerung oder Fortsetzung" eingestellt sein. Bitte beachten Sie die Hinweise unten. |
* //Zeitpunkt//\\ Entweder die Verzögerung bis zum Versand (in Sekunden, maximal 153900000) __oder__ ein Unix-Zeitstempel, der den Zeitpunkt für den nächsten Versand definiert. | * //Zeitpunkt//\\ Entweder die Verzögerung bis zum Versand (in Sekunden, maximal 153900000) __oder__ ein Unix-Zeitstempel, der den Zeitpunkt für den nächsten Versand definiert. |
* //C1// bis //C3// (optional)\\ Wenn Sie hier einen Text angeben (optional), können Sie diesen Text mithilfe der Platzhalter ''%custom1%'' bis ''%custom3%'' in der Serienmail verwenden. In Verbindung mit ''value()'' können Sie also sogar Antworten aus dem laufenden Interview in der E-Mail anzeigen. | * //C1// bis //C5// (optional)\\ Wenn Sie hier einen Text angeben (optional), können Sie diesen Text mithilfe der Platzhalter ''%custom1%'' bis ''%custom5%'' in der Serienmail verwenden. In Verbindung mit ''value()'' können Sie beispielsweise Antworten aus dem laufenden Interview in der E-Mail anzeigen. |
| |
===== Hinweise ===== | ===== Hinweise ===== |
// Zeit speichern | // Zeit speichern |
$timeBreak1 = time(); | $timeBreak1 = time(); |
registerVariable('timeBreak1'); | registerVariable($timeBreak1); |
// E-Mail vorbereiten | // E-Mail vorbereiten |
// Serienmail mit der Kennung 2 genau in 14 Tagen versenden | // Serienmail mit der Kennung 2 genau in 14 Tagen versenden |
mailResume('ABCDE123', 3, 0); | mailResume('ABCDE123', 3, 0); |
</code> | </code> |
| |
| |
| ===== Serienmail nach Opt-In-Frage ===== |
| |
| Mit einer Frage vom Typ [[:de:create:questions:opt-in]] kann man im Fragebogen E-Mail-Adressen abfragen und direkt in die Adressliste (**Einladungen verschicken** -> **Adressliste**) eintragen, sodass man später Serienmails an die E-Mail-Adressen versenden kann. |
| |
| Dieser Abschnitt erklärt, wie man mittels ''[[:de:create:functions:mailschedule]]'' automatisch den zeitgesteuerten oder unmittelbaren Versand einer Serienmail an die eingetragene E-Mail-Adresse auslöst. |
| |
| Bei der Opt-In-Frage gibt es zwei Mechanismen: Das Double-Opt-In (der Teilnehmer muss den Adresseintrag erst via Bestätigungsmail bestätigen, empfohlen) und das Single-Opt-In, bei welchem die (möglicherweise falsche) E-Mail-Adresse direkt gespeichert wird. |
| |
| Beim Double-Opt-In ist es sinnvoll, den Versand erst nach Bestätigung der Mailadresse auszulösen. |